USC recruiting: Tight end Tyler Petite signs with Trojans
- Share via
USC has received a letter of intent from Tyler Petite, the school announced.
Player: Tyler Petite
Position: Tight end
Height: 6 feet 5
Weight: 225
High School: Moraga Campolindo
Verbally committed: Dec. 12, 2014
Schools considered: Duke
Notes: Under Armour All-American … Petite committed to Duke over USC in July before he changed his commitment.
Petite on choosing USC:
“I chose USC because of the great football family and the atmosphere. The coaches are awesome and the players are awesome. Also, from an education standpoint, there is nothing like USC and how powerful a degree from USC is.”
Petite on signing a letter of intent:
“It feels great. I’m glad that it’s finally over and I can officially be a Trojan. It’s all becoming a reality now and I can’t wait to get going.”
